Galle's Ocean Crosswinds Pose Key Challenge for India's Spinners
India's spinners are expected to face a significant challenge adapting to the unpredictable crosswinds at Galle during their upcoming contest against Sri Lanka. The venue's coastal location means the ocean breeze has a notable effect on the ball's drift, complicating spin bowling strategies. Former cricketers have stressed the importance of spinners making quick adjustments to turn the wind conditions to their advantage. Young spinner Manav Suthar, known for his rhythmic bowling action, has been identified as a potential asset for India in these conditions. Effectively reading and harnessing the wind at Galle is seen as a decisive factor in determining the outcome of the match.
